Evidence for nonsingular vorticity in the Helsinki experiments on rotating /sup 3/He-A

Journal Article · · J. Low Temp. Phys.; (United States)
DOI:https://doi.org/10.1007/BF00683557· OSTI ID:5909218
A theory for the satellite peak in the NMR spectrum of rotating superfluid /sup 3/He--A is presented. Absorption at the frequency of the satellite is produced by spin waves localized on vortex lines. The peak frequency and total intensity of the satellite are calculated for both singular and nonsingular vortices: a comparison with the Helsinki NMR data strongly suggests that nonsingular vorticity was actually observed in the experiments.
